// Seat-map renderer for the Gildercrest Playhouse booking flow.
// These constants control tile sizing, zoom clamps, and the viewport
// culling margin. We raised the cull margin after the balcony rows
// popped in late during fast pans (flagged at last week's sync).
// Changing tile size requires regenerating the sprite atlas, so
// coordinate with the assets pipeline first. Current values follow.

tuning table, tahof-kahof:
CAPS = {
    "quenius": 223,
    "julath": 185,
    "brivan": 91,
    "aldvan": 240,
    "wenmir": 452,
    "fraath": 856,
    "novys": 62,
}

## PayWhirl Environments

Welcome aboard! Our staging environment is where the flaky integration tests live — mostly timeouts against the mock card gateway. If a test fails twice, rerun it before panicking; it's usually staging being staging. Before debugging anything, make sure your local setup matches the staging config below.

deployment values, kajep-kageg:
[praix]
host = praix.paliqcorp.corp
user = praix_svc
database = praix_prod

Minutes — Management Meeting, Supplier Renewal

Present: Orla, Dev, Marit. Topic: Quillane Components contract renewal. Agreed to extend 12 months, not 36, pending quality audit results. Pricing holds flat; freight terms shift to delivered. Dev to draft amendment by Friday. Sales leads should not signal renewal terms externally. One point is for internal eyes only.

board note of tadup-tajog: Headcount on the Oliiel team goes from 31 to 88 by the end of February. Gross margin on Oliiel came in at 62 percent against a plan of 29 percent.

## Deployment

The Brindlewood site uses incremental rebuilds: only pages whose content hashes changed are regenerated, so deploys usually finish in under a minute. Pushes to the main branch trigger the Lanternjack build runner automatically. Full rebuilds happen weekly or when templates change. Before your first deploy, confirm the runner is using these values:

config for hahaf-kafof:
[wenys]
host = wenys.torvahq.corp
user = wenys_svc
database = wenys_prod